Bhataha Village - Harraiya, Basti

Bhataha is a village situated in the Harraiya tehsil of Basti district, Uttar Pradesh. It is located approximately 20 km from the tehsil headquarters in Harraiya and around 25 km from the district headquarters in Basti. Naryanpur serves as the Gram Panchayat for Bhataha village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Bhataha is 180330. The village covers a total geographical area of 137.9 hectares and falls under the 272131 pincode. Basti is the nearest town, located about 25 km away.

Bhataha village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Kaptanganj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Basti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Bhataha

As per Census 2011, Bhataha village has a total population of 515 people, consisting of 262 males and 253 females. The village has 85 households and a sex ratio of 965 females per 1,000 males. There are 82 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 301 literate and 214 illiterate residents. Additionally, 55 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Bhataha

Bhataha is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is Tinich, while the nearest airport is Gorakhpur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 70.9 km.
